Choosing a Niche

The first step in starting a blog is to decide on a niche. Your niche is the topic or theme of your blog. It's important to choose a niche that you are passionate about and that you have knowledge and expertise in. This will make it easier weblog website for you to create engaging and valuable content for your readers. Some popular blog niches include travel, food, fashion, health and wellness, personal finance, and technology. Take some time to brainstorm and research different niches to find the one that best suits your interests and skills.

Setting Up Your Blog

Once you have chosen a niche, it's time to set up your blog. There are several platforms you can use to start a blog, such as WordPress, Blogger, and blog Squarespace. WordPress is one of the most popular blogging platforms, as it offers a wide range of customization options and is user-friendly. To set up a blog site blog on WordPress, you will need to choose a domain name, select a hosting provider, and install WordPress on your hosting account. You can then customize the design of your blog by choosing a theme and adding plugins to enhance its functionality.

Creating Quality Content

Now that your blog is set up, it's time to start creating content. The key to a successful blog is to consistently produce high-quality and engaging content that resonates with your target audience. Think about what type of content your readers would find valuable and interesting, such as how-to guides, tutorials, product reviews, and personal stories. Be sure to use a mix of text, images, and videos to make your content visually appealing and engaging. And don't forget to optimize your content for search engines by using relevant keywords and meta tags.

Promoting Your Blog

Once you have created quality content for your blog, the next step is to promote it. There are several ways you can promote your blog and attract more readers. You can share your blog posts on social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ram, engage with other bloggers in your niche through guest posting and collaborations, and optimize your blog for search engines to improve its visibility online. You can also build an email list and send out newsletters to keep your readers informed about new blog posts and updates.

Monetizing Your Blog

If you're looking to make money from your blog, there are several ways you can monetize it. You can earn money through affiliate marketing by promoting products and services from other companies and earning a blog website commission on sales. You can also display ads on your blog through ad networks like Google AdSense or work with brands on sponsored content. Another way to monetize your blog is to create and sell your own products or services, such as ebooks, online courses, or consulting services. Keep in mind that it may take some time to build up a loyal readership and generate income from your blog, so be patient and persistent.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How often should I post on my blog?

It's important to keep a consistent posting schedule to keep your readers engaged. Aim to post at least once a week, but you can post more frequently if you have the time and resources.

2. How can I attract more readers to my blog?

To attract more readers to your blog, focus on creating high-quality content that addresses the needs and interests of your target audience. You can also promote your blog through social media, guest posting, and search engine optimization.

3. Is it necessary to have a professional design for my blog?

While having a professional design can make your blog more visually appealing, it is not necessary to have one when you are just starting out. Focus on creating valuable content and building your audience, and you can invest in a design upgrade later on.

4. How can I engage with my readers and build a community around my blog?

Engaging with your readers is key to building a loyal following for your blog. Encourage comments and feedback on your posts, respond to comments and questions from your readers, and consider hosting contests or giveaways to encourage interaction and participation.

5. How long does it take to start making money from my blog?

The timeline for making money from your blog can vary depending on factors such as your niche, the quality of your content, and your promotional efforts. Some bloggers may start earning income within a few months, while others may take longer. It's important to be patient and consistent in your efforts to grow your blog and monetize it.
